User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 6.1; en-US) AppleWebKit/533.2 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/5.0.342.8 Safari/533.2 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 6.1; en-GB; rv:1.9.1.9) Gecko/20100317 Thunderbird/3.0.4 It would be helpful to have some documentation for the syntax of the "Search all messages" option. It would be good to have options for building more complex queries. E.g. "to:Bob AND body:agenda item%" E.g. "sent:after 1/1/2010" Explorer in Windows Vista and Windows 7 has quite a nice syntax like this in its "search" boxes. Perhaps this could be an inspiration. Reproducible: Always Expected Results: Ability to locate desired message quickly and easily.
